Emergency Exemption (Section 18) Granted for Sivanto in Sweet Sorghum

Sugarcane aphids

The Tennessee Department of Agriculture and the EPA has again approved a Section 18 that allows the use of Sivanto prime on sweet sorghum for the control of sugarcane aphids during 2019. This pest is potentially devastating for those growing sweet sorghum for molasses or other uses, and Sivanto prime is an excellent any the only available insecticide option in this crop. Specific requirement for it’s use are summarized below and detailed in the linked authorization letter.

  • No more than 4 applications can be made by ground or air
  • The approved use rate for a single application is 4 – 10.5 fluid oz/acre, but a season total of no more than 28 oz can be applied per acre
  • 21-day pre-harvest interval
  • 7-day minimum retreatment interval
